ISLAMABAD: Heera Ashiq, Faizan Khurram and Samir Iftikhar have been selected to represent Pakistan in the South Asian Boys Under-16 Tennis Championship to be held at Dhaka (Bangladesh) from November 8-14.
The players were selected after four-day trials which concluded here at PTF Tennis Complex on Thursday.
Up to 18 players reported for the trials for the selection of Junior team.
The players were divided into 6 groups, from which top 6 players were selected after round robin matches.
Top player from each group qualified for the final round robin, who were Heera Ashiq, Sadan ul Haq, Faizan Khurram, Samir Iftikhar, Muhammad Abid and Syed Zohair Raza.
In the final round robin matches, Heera Ashiq and Faizan Khurram won 4 matches out of five with the game score of 59 and 55 respectively while Samir Iftikhar won 3 matches with the game score of 54.
Pakistan Junior tennis team will participate in the 1st SAF (South Asian Federation) Tennis Championships in Dhaka - Bangladesh.
Non Playing Captain/Coach will be selected by President PTF. These trials were held under the supervision of Fazal-e-Subhan, a renowned coach from Islamabad Tennis Complex, along with Muhammad Khalil Joint Secretary PTF. The team will leave for Bangladesh on November 7. |
